
You are invited to an online talk I will be presenting on 15 September, on the subject of self-publishing history books.
The event is for Vauxhall History and Friends of Tate South Lambeth and is part of 2021 Lambeth Heritage Festival – but is open to everyone wherever you are in the world.
It will be recorded and posted on YouTube – so don’t worry if you miss it. You can always catch up later.
I will be covering research, preparation of the manuscript, print platforms, crowdfunding, ebooks, marketing and sales, using my own experiences.
The focus of the talk will on how to survive the process and get a good result rather than on writing the book itself. Although I have three books listed with Pen&Sword, and therefore have experience of mainstream publishing, I have also self-published. In 2010 I wrote and self-published These Were Our Sons (under the name Naomi Lourie Klein), about the 547 men listed on my local war memorial. Now I am about to publish Under Fire: The Blitz Diaries of a Volunteer Ambulance Driver.
